Underestimating Product Demands



When tackling a roof covering repair, among the most typical errors is ignoring the materials you'll need. You might think you can escape buying simply a little added, yet this typically causes running out mid-project. This can delay your repair and enhance your costs due to emergency situation trips to the store.

To avoid this, start by assessing the location that requires repair work. Measure the measurements precisely, and do not fail to remember to account for any additional product required for overlaps or cuts.

Bear in mind that different roof materials have particular demands. As an example, shingles might need a specific number of packages per square foot, while underlayment and blinking have their very own standards.


It's likewise smart to think about climate condition that might influence your repair service. If rainfall is in the forecast, you'll want added products handy to wrap things up rapidly.

Disregarding Safety And Security Measures



Forgeting security preventative measures can turn a simple roof repair service into an unsafe situation. You could think you can avoid the safety and security equipment or climb onto your roof without a ladder, yet this can cause serious accidents. Constantly use a hard hat, non-slip footwear, and a harness to assist maintain you protect.

Prior to you begin, see to it to inspect your work area. Eliminate any debris that could trigger you to journey or lose your footing. If you're working on a sloped roofing system, think about utilizing scaffolding or roof covering brackets for included security.

Never work alone; having someone close by can be a lifesaver in case of an emergency.

Also, bear in mind the weather. Wet or gusty problems can enhance the threat of slips and drops, so it's ideal to delay your job if the climate isn't coordinating.

Ultimately, stay familiar with your environments. Electrical cables and overhanging branches can present risks while you're up there.

Skipping Expert Assistance



While you may feel confident in dealing with roof repairs on your own, skipping professional assistance can result in expensive errors. Lots of home owners undervalue the complexity of roofing issues. What appears like a straightforward leak could actually come from a much bigger problem, such as architectural damage or improper ventilation.

Without the appropriate competence, you can wind up making the scenario even worse, which can bring about much more substantial repair services and greater costs down the line.

Additionally, professionals have accessibility to specialized tools and materials that you might not. They can spot potential issues that you might forget, making sure a thorough repair service. You may assume you're conserving money by doing it on your own, but employing a certified specialist can really conserve you cash in the future.

Furthermore, roofing job can be unsafe. Specialists are trained to function securely at elevations, reducing the danger of crashes. They additionally frequently provide warranties on their work, supplying you assurance.
